1. A car travels 19 km in 35 minutes. What is its average speed?
2. A plane on an aircraft carrier can be launched from 0 to 50 m/s in 2.4 seconds. What is
the acceleration of the jet?
3. What is the average momentum of a 37-kg skateboarder who covers 450 m in 40s?
4. A 15-kg cement block moving horizontally at 10 m/s plows into a bank of stone and
comes to a stop in 1.9 s. What is the average impact force on the bank of stone?
5. An 80-kg free-floating astronaut throws a 1.20-kg hammer at a speed of 6.50 m/s from
their tool belt. What is the astronaut's recoil speed?
6. You push with 15.0 N on a 10.0-kg block and there are no opposing forces. How fast will
the block accelerate?

7. You push with 37 N on a 5-kg table, and there is a 7-N force of friction. How fast will the
table accelerate?
Conceptual Physics
8. Suppose that you exert 500 N horizontally on a 60-kg crate on a flat level surface, where
friction between the crate and the surface is 100 N. What is the acceleration of the
crate?
9. A package falls out of a plane that is traveling horizontally at 90 m/s. It falls onto the
ground below 8.0 seconds later. Assuming no air resistance, what is the horizontal
distance it travels while falling?
10. Tom throws a rock horizontally from the top of a building that is 10.0 m high. He hopes
the rock will reach a pond that is at the bottom of the building, 20.0.0 m horizontally
from the edge the building. If the rock is to reach the pond, with what initial speed must
Tom throw it with?
11. What is the work done in lifting a 60kg of blocks to a height of 15m?

12. A toy cart moves with a kinetic energy of 20 J. If the speed is doubled, what will its
kinetic energy be?
Conceptual Physics
13. What amount of work can a 200W motor do in 5 minutes?
14. A person sitting of a sofa doing nothing all day except watching TV can consume 7
million J of energy in a day. What is this rate of energy consumption in watts?
15. A 30kg girl runs up the stairs to a floor 5m higher in 8 seconds. What is her power
output in watts? What is it in horsepower? (1hp = 750 watts)
